随着区块链技术的快速发展以及数字资产的广泛应用,数字钱包的需求日益增加。数字钱包不仅仅是存储数字货币的工具,它们还起到连接用户与区块链网络的重要桥梁作用。在现代金融体系中,理解钱包如何接入区块链,是每一个希望参与这一革命性技术的用户必须掌握的内容。
数字钱包可分为热钱包和冷钱包。热钱包随时连接互联网,方便进行快速交易,而冷钱包则是离线存储,提供更高级别的安全性。尽管两者在便利性与安全性上有所不同,它们都需要以某种方式与区块链进行互动。
为了更好地理解钱包如何接入区块链,首先需要了解区块链的基本工作原理。区块链是一种分布式账本技术,它通过去中心化的数据存储方式,确保所有交易的透明性与安全性。所有的数据以“区块”的形式存储,并组成一个不可篡改的链。这种结构有效防止了数据的伪造和篡改,确保了系统的安全性和可靠性。
钱包要接入区块链,首先需要实现与区块链节点的连接。区块链网络由无数个节点组成,钱包需要通过API或者直接的区块链协议来与这些节点进行通信。例如,使用以太坊网络的数字钱包可以通过以太坊节点的API来检测余额、发送交易等。
数字钱包的安全性主要依赖于密钥管理。用户的私钥是唯一能够控制其数字资产的凭证。因此,钱包需要通过加密技术来保护这些密钥,确保用户在交易过程中的安全。此外,钱包的设计应提供便捷的恢复机制,以防用户丢失私钥。这种管理机制不仅提升了用户体验,也增强了钱包与区块链的交互安全性。
接入区块链的数字钱包,用户界面的设计是至关重要的。钱包提供的功能字典越丰富,用户的选择就越多。良好的用户体验能够吸引更多用户使用该钱包,并通过他们的反馈不断迭代。功能如历史记录、余额显示、转账操作等都需要以的形式呈现,确保用户在使用时的流畅性。
智能合约的引入,为钱包与区块链的互动增添了新的维度。它们是自动执行的合约,能够在交易达到特定条件时自动完成。通过集成智能合约,钱包能提供更复杂的金融服务,如去中心化的交易平台、借贷服务等。用户在钱包中通过智能合约进行交易时,减轻了由人工操作引起的错误概率。
市场上的区块链网络有很多种,如比特币、以太坊、波场等,每个网络都有其独特的技术架构。因此,实现跨链钱包的建设,才能满足用户在不同区块链网络间的无缝转账需求。这需要开发者对不同网络的协议有深入的理解,同时借助相应的跨链技术,对钱包的设计进行。
不可否认的是,随着用户对数字资产认知的提升,钱包安全性的重要性愈加突出。钱包开发者在设计时,务必考虑各类潜在的安全风险,诸如网络攻击、钓鱼网站、密码泄露等等。此时,采用两步验证、多重签名和硬件钱包等措施,则能够显著提升用户资产的安全指数。
随着区块链技术的普及,各国政府逐渐加强对数字货币的监管。因此,一个钱包在接入区块链时,必须考虑合规性。实现与当地法律法规的有效对接,确保钱包能够合法运营,不仅有助于树立品牌形象,也可以保护用户的权益。
未来,随着技术的不断进步,钱包与区块链的整合将日益紧密。移动支付、分布式金融(DeFi)、NFT市场将成为钱包接入的热点领域。同时,用户的安全意识不断增强,使得安全性更成为技术研发的重要目标。因此,无论是对于开发者还是普通用户而言,深入了解钱包如何接入区块链,将助力提升其实用性和价值,拓宽数字经济的视野。
通过对钱包如何接入区块链的全面分析,我们可以看到这其中所蕴含的技术复杂性与丰富的业务应用场景。随着数字货币市场的不断成熟,区块链钱包的未来充满无限可能。